About Legal Malpractice Law in Happy Valley, Hong Kong

Legal Malpractice refers to situations where a lawyer fails to perform their duties competently. In Happy Valley, Hong Kong, legal malpractice cases can arise when a lawyer breaches their duty of care, commits negligence, or engages in unethical behavior.

Why You May Need a Lawyer

You may require a lawyer for legal malpractice issues if you have received inadequate legal representation, advice, or services from a lawyer that has caused you harm or resulted in a negative outcome in your legal matter.

Local Laws Overview

In Happy Valley, Hong Kong, legal malpractice claims are typically governed by common law principles and professional regulations. The Legal Practitioners Ordinance and rules set by The Law Society of Hong Kong may also apply to malpractice cases.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. What constitutes legal malpractice in Hong Kong?

Legal malpractice in Hong Kong generally involves a lawyer's failure to meet the required standard of care, resulting in harm to the client.

2. How do I prove legal malpractice?

To prove legal malpractice, you typically need to establish that the lawyer breached their duty of care, caused you harm, and that the harm was a direct result of the lawyer's actions.

3. What damages can I recover in a legal malpractice case?

Damages in a legal malpractice case may include compensation for financial losses, emotional distress, and other harm caused by the lawyer's negligence.

4. Is there a time limit for filing a legal malpractice claim in Happy Valley, Hong Kong?

Yes, there is a limitation period for filing legal malpractice claims in Hong Kong, usually within six years from the date of the negligence or breach of duty.

5. Can I file a legal malpractice claim against a lawyer who represented me in a criminal case?

Yes, you can file a legal malpractice claim against any lawyer who provided you with legal representation, regardless of the nature of the case.

6. Is legal malpractice different from professional misconduct?

Legal malpractice refers to negligence or incompetence in providing legal services, while professional misconduct involves unethical or improper behavior by a lawyer.

7. Can I report a lawyer for legal malpractice in Happy Valley, Hong Kong?

If you believe a lawyer has committed legal malpractice, you can file a complaint with The Law Society of Hong Kong, which regulates lawyers' professional conduct.

8. Can I sue my lawyer for legal malpractice if I lost my case?

Losing a case does not automatically constitute legal malpractice. To sue your lawyer for malpractice, you must prove that their actions or inactions directly caused harm to you.

9. How much does it cost to hire a lawyer for a legal malpractice case?

The cost of hiring a lawyer for a legal malpractice case can vary depending on the complexity of the case, the lawyer's fees, and other factors. Some lawyers may provide initial consultations for free.

10. How long does a legal malpractice case typically take to resolve?

The timeline for resolving a legal malpractice case can vary depending on factors such as the complexity of the case, the willingness of the parties to negotiate, and the court's schedule. It can take months to several years to reach a resolution.
